How much does it cost to rent a home in Sugar House?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sugar House 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,020 | $1,250 | $3,200 |
| Sugar House 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,595 | $1,840 | $3,875 |
| Sugar House 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,179 | $653 | $10,000+ |
| Sugar House 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,872 | $750 | $2,995 |
| Sugar House 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,700 | $3,700 | $3,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Sugar House
What type of rentals are currently available in Sugar House?
There are currently 175 Apartments for Rent in Sugar House, UT with pricing that ranges from $630 to $16,764. There are also 75 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Sugar House ranging from $653 to $10,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Sugar House?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Sugar House ranges from $653 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,398.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Sugar House?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Sugar House range from $1,840 to $7,028,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,840 to $3,875.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$653 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$640.
